Only doing CFD is just being stubborn nowadays (or penny-short pound-foolish). Nick Wirth, who's a priest of that religion, has never developed anything good, and there's lot of racing programs compromised because of this belief in the magic of computers. The Navier-Stokes equations are computationally very hard and can only be numerically approximated in several critical areas of the car's flow.

With 3D printing there's really no point in not doing a model, it's not that expensive and tunnel time can be found in lots of places.
I've heard numbers as high as 100k (sorry can't for the life of me remember US or Euro based reporting to know, dollars, pounds or Euros) a DAY for wind tunnel time, add in employees needed on site and bits to test that's a LOT of money for that team to absorb.
